You are on course 027°T and take a relative bearing to a lighthouse of 220°. What is the true bearing to the lighthouse?
Official USCG Answer & Rule Citation
Correct Answer: Option C — 247°
Applying Bowditch conversion rules, True Bearing equals True Course plus Relative Bearing (TB = TC + RB). Adding 027° and 220° equals 247°T, directly providing the true direction of the charted navigational aid.
